Output 390ac3da260f856b326612d24c0fd713f8edcadbd46b73235f4a0d2273b0906e:3

value
508326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4ff9141b026a0e65e5e9bf8addb978e89faa2b OP_EQUAL
address
3BZiht1fcYNkRNmrXttF6qEaGic71QGByU
transaction
390ac3da260f856b326612d24c0fd713f8edcadbd46b73235f4a0d2273b0906e
spent
true